feat(android): fragment transactions to use 'add' instead of 'replace' on fwd navigation (#8791)
Changes the behavior of android fragment transactions to use `add` instead of `replace` on forward navigation. BREAKING CHANGE: Changes the internal behavior of Android navigation: * while navigating forward, the page navigated from is not unloaded anymore * events order is changed in the sense that now `unloaded` happens after `navigatedFrom` instead of before There are multiple plus sides to this: * no more black views on navigation when using opengl (maps, ...) * navigation is faster, especially the navigation back! No longer need to recreate the page anymore. Navigation forward also gets faster as we no longer unload the previous page * navigatedFrom event happens faster * this the default behavior used by most of the android native apps
